Wallace, Idaho experiences heavy snowfall and cold winters, leading to frequent pipe freezing and spring snowmelt flooding. These conditions create a high risk of water damage, especially in homes located at higher elevations near Silverton, ID.
Most water extraction removal calls in Wallace come from snowmelt flooding and pipe freezing in high-elevation homes. Local mold risk: Wallace has low humidity levels, which can slow mold growth compared to more humid regions. However, once water intrusion occurs, the risk of mold still exists within 48-72 hours, especially in basements and lower-level rooms.
